Every island of Thailand is popular for its uniqueness. One such island is Ko Phi Phi which is a small archipelago in the Krabi Province in Southern Thailand. It is the largest island of the group and to the surprise of many it is the only island with permanent inhabitants. The smaller Ko Phi Phi Leh Island is famous as the filming location of the Leonardo DiCaprio starrer movie “The Beach” released in the year 2000. After the Tsunami of December 2004 the island is back on track and the services are back with building regulations in place to preserve the scenic beauty of the island. The tour starts by picking you up from the hotel at around 5 a.m. in the morning to the site of meeting via a minivan or a bus. Then you can enjoy the breakfast at a beautiful scenic location anywhere in Phuket Island prior departure to your first destination. Maya Bay It is mostly tide dependent and is the first stop in the tour list. The Island became famous when the film “The Beach” starring Leonardo DiCaprio released in 2000 was filmed here. This is a must see island and usually gets very busy because of its popularity. It’s a great place to take some great photos as it is very picturesque. Pileh Lagoon This is the second destination of the tour. Phileh Lagoon just looks amazing because of its emerald lagoon which is surrounded by high limestone cliffs. It is quite popular as being the world’s most gorgeous natural swimming pool. It is famous for its traditional jump off from the boat front by the tourists. Swimming here in the crystal clear water gives a soothing experience. Morning Snorkeling For snorkeling there are numerous places to choose from like the Viking Cove, Loh Somah Bay, Dragon Lagoon, Straight Rock or Par Dang. The tour guide chooses the location because of sea conditions, tide and other tour groups. Equipments including flippers, life jackets and swim noodles are provided by the tour operator and the staff is always present in and out of the water to help the tourists. Monkey Beach It’s the fourth stop in the tour list and is a perfect place to catch up with the local monkeys. Tourists are mostly advised to keep away from monkeys as they can bite. This is a good place to spend some good time. Bamboo Island This is one of the most beautiful islands of the Ko Phi Phi group and is also the stop for lunch. Buffet lunch is generally arranged on the powdery beach of the Island which is a great experience in itself. Afternoon Snorkeling After enjoying the lunch its time again to have some fun with another snorkeling stop. Here there are many options to choose from like Nui Bay (Camel Rock), Mosquito Island, Hin Klan or in front of Bamboo Island. All these places are house to coral reefs with an abundance of sea life.
